How they compare
Liechtenstein currently reports 891 against 878 in Cook Islands, a difference of 13.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 15 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Liechtenstein ahead.
Cook Islands ranks 168th and Liechtenstein ranks 167th of 174 countries.
Liechtenstein has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cook Islands | Liechtenstein |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 739.5 | 750 | 10.5 | Liechtenstein |
| 2000s | 812.7 | 852.8 | 40.1 | Liechtenstein |
| 2010s | 877.67 | 880.67 | 3 | Liechtenstein |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
